Christmas Parade 2017
Some of the sights at the 2017 Christmas Parade in Leesburg, Virginia.
Cleaning the streets after the 2017 Christmas Parade in Leesburg, Virginia.
Snowy Flags
Snow-frosted flags on South King Street, Leesburg, VA after the first snow of the 2017-2018 Winter.
Loudoun County Courthouse
Loudoun County Courthouse after the first snow of the 2017-2018 Winter. This snow fell on the same day as the annual Christmas Parade.
Jingle Jam 2017
View of one of the projectors displaying the background for the concert.